Series Elastic Actuators have linear springs intentionally placed in series between the motor and actuator output. The spring strain is measured to get an accurate estimate of force. Despite using a transmission to achieve high force/mass and high power/mass, the spring allows for good force control, high force fidelity, minimum impedance, and large dynamic range. Spring meshes have been used to model elastic material in computer graphics, with skin, textiles, and soft tissue being typical applications. A spring mesh is a system of vertices and edges, possibly with highly irregular geometry, in which each edge is a spring, and springs are connected by \pin-joints" (\gimbal-joints" in 3D) at the vertices. The Series Elastic Actuator (SEA) has recently been developed by many research groups and applied in various fields. As SEA is the combination of motor, spring, gear and load, various types and configurations of mechanism have been developed as SEAs to satisfy many requirements necessary for the applications. A numerical method is described for studying how elastic waves interact with imperfect contacts such as fractures or glue layers existing between elastic solids. These contacts have been classicaly modeled by interfaces, using a simple rheological model consisting of a combination of normal and tangential linear springs and masses.
